UAE PILOT BEGINS 45-DAY NASA MARS PROJECT

Image
  An Emirati pilot selected for NASA's mission to artificial Mars is set to begin his mission in Houston, Texas. Sharif al-Ramithi and crew members will live and work in isolation inside a special habitat for 45 days for the project, which will simulate a trip to the Red Planet. In April, the Mohammed Bin Rashid Space Center announced the selection of Al Ramithi for the second analog study of the UAE's analog program, as part of NASA's research mission. The project is designed to help scientists study how crew members adapt to difficult conditions before they embark on deep space missions. The team will spend time in the confined space environment to see what the impact of the isolation is on organ functions. The UAE is taking part in four phases of the research, each of which lasts for 45 days.

New Mars Map Reveals Stunning Geological Features and Answers to Pressing Questions

Image
A recently published high-resolution map of Mars has provided scientists with new insights into the planet's geological history, as well as clues to the mystery of its dry and barren landscape. The map, which was created using data collected by NASA 's Mars Reconnaissance Orbiter, has revealed a wealth of fascinating geological features in stunning detail. One of the most intriguing questions that the map could help scientists answer is how Mars, which was once abundant with liquid water, became the dry, arid, and barren landscape that we see today. According to the map, there are signs of ancient lakes, rivers, and even a massive ocean that once covered a significant portion of the planet's surface. So what happened to all that water? One theory is that the water was lost to space over time as the planet's atmosphere thinned out. Another possibility is that the water was absorbed into the planet's surface rocks and minerals, where it remains locked away to this day...
